<p><strong>From The BBC:</strong> <strong>The street art collective Poster Boy has announced that its first solo show at Connecticut&#8217;s Trinity College would be cancelled due to legal concerns. Can the anti-consumer vandals ever go straight? And would they want to?</strong></p>
<p>Three years ago, a vandal with a creative streak caught the attention of the New York media. Dubbed Poster Boy and armed only with a razor blade, he cut up vinyl ads on the subway, turning bright, cheerful marketing campaigns into freakish collages.</p>
<p>The work was exciting but illegal. In 2009 and 2010, 27-year old Henry Matyjewicz was arrested twice, and later admitted his identity as Poster Boy in court&#8230;</p>

<p><strong>The following is an interview that Poster Boy conducted with WTPF last year:</strong></p>
<p>WTPF: how would you describe the relationship between vanguard art and danger, and for you, which element is more important: the aesthetic plastic result of the piece, or the power of provocation of the piece? both of these elements are strongly present in your work, and i wonder if you plan the execution of a piece before you render it. also, please explain the importance of improvisation in your work.</p>
<p>PB: Danger is part of the medium. Without the element of danger the current vanguard would lose an edge that wasn&#8217;t really present in preceding movements. As far as aesthetics and provocation goes, both are necessary in art. Well, good art least.<br />
For better or worse, I don&#8217;t plan much. For me, improvisation is protest against the urge to preserve, polish, and market everything. Something I learned from the Jazz and Hip Hop.</p>
<p>WTPF: can art change the world or does art only change art? does it even matter? feel free to elaborate.</p>
<p>PB: Art does change the world, but only for those who have the imagination to realize it.</p>
<p>WTPF: what do you think about this statement: â€œThe ultimate protest is against the silence of God?</p>
<p>PB: I feel every act is a reaction to Godâ€™s silence. Whether its protest depends on the person&#8217;s understanding of God/consciousness.</p>
<p>WTPF: what inspires me the most about your art, and the movement in which you are one of its leaders, is that a dialectical relationship exists between the work and the audience. in your case, other Poster Boys and Girls have adopted your methods, and have become protagonists. were you surprised that this occurred?</p>
<p>PB: I wasn&#8217;t surprised at all. I actually anticipated this by establishing Poster Boy as a platform for anyone willing to participate. People want to feel alive, but apathy is a serious hurdle for some. Which is probably why the act of illegal poster alteration, however trivial, has been so inspirational and empowering.</p>
<p>WTPF: Your soon to be released book &#8220;The War Of Art&#8221;, is in my opinion a poem of transformations of transgressions. the transgressions being the vapid and polluting influence of the commercial propaganda that you transform into art and revolutionary statement. Salvador Dali once described himself as a pig that consumes all of the slop of modernity, and shits out gold. Dali of course kept all the gold for himself: why do you do it? please explain what motivates you the most to do what you do.</p>
<p>PB: The book is a poem. A work of art in itself rather than a collection.<br />
I used to resent the fact that I had no positive role models growing up. So now I aspire to be the role model I wish I had. Truth is what motivates me.</p>

<p><strong>Fu.mer.o.ism  (fooâ€™mareâ€™ohâ€™izm) n. 1. A movement in modern art developed at the crossroads of the 20th â€“ 21st c., based upon the idea of illustrating form with an exaggeration toward abstraction combined with a wide range of intense, unnatural â€˜skittled-colorsâ€™ enveloped by a continuous black contour  2. A harmonious infusion among expressive lines, shapes and colors  3. Intense; bright â€“ distorted; linear.<br />
</strong></p>

<p><strong>Too Many Bugs</strong> (33 Haikus by JHM)</p>
<p>My voice is choking<br />
from too many grasshoppers.<br />
I wish i could sing.</p>
<p>Cicada cadence:<br />
Everything must be written<br />
and it will be law.</p>
<p>My mother was stung,<br />
and by serendipity<br />
i came to being.</p>
<p>How to cover ass:<br />
Burrow like a Cicada;<br />
Hide from predators.</p>
<p>Voices of crickets<br />
describe our moment of death.<br />
Tiny violins.</p>
<p>All crickets must die.<br />
Their tiny violins crushed<br />
by the conductor.</p>
<p>I don&#8217;t like roaches,<br />
because they make me jealous;<br />
They scare girls away.</p>
<p>Metamorphosis:<br />
Gregor Samsa is my friend<br />
and so is his dad.</p>
<p>Music and laughter.<br />
According to Kant we can&#8217;t<br />
understand insects.</p>
<p>Heavenly beehive:<br />
Where angels are the insects<br />
stinging men to death.</p>
<p>Katydid or not<br />
is the telescoping gag<br />
that fossilizes us.</p>
<p>For mother mantis:<br />
I did not want to exist.<br />
Why did you mate me?</p>
<p>Is there shame in this?<br />
Lorca was devoured by<br />
fascists and maggots.</p>
<p>Insect universe:<br />
Where sound devours silence<br />
and we are silent.</p>
<p>Bunuel loved insects.<br />
He knew what was coming to him.<br />
They took him away.</p>
<p>Dante observed bugs;<br />
In Empyrean, angels<br />
swarm heaven like bees.</p>
<p>The universe drones<br />
and a wurlitzer of bones<br />
whistles a graveyard.</p>
<p>Creeley lost an eye<br />
and that socket was a hive<br />
for a swarm of bees.</p>
<p>The katydid speaks<br />
in a language that fools know:<br />
Binary Hipster.</p>
<p>Who killed the poet?<br />
Only Lorca knows the truth:<br />
The sound of crickets.</p>
<p>My corpse is shameful.<br />
Insects devour my sex<br />
while i am naked.</p>
<p>What i expected:<br />
God dreamed me and then woke up.<br />
Thank you for the flies.</p>
<p>Bugs Devour God:<br />
His great book is on a vine<br />
that xtians consume.</p>
<p>If God were a bug,<br />
I would stomp it and crush it.<br />
I hate intruders.</p>
<p>You make me human.<br />
Exoskeleton in you<br />
dissolves in your sex.</p>
<p>The universe dies,<br />
and like a praying mantis<br />
is a cannibal.</p>
<p>There is no way out.<br />
We are in the roach motel<br />
that god left to us.</p>
<p>The flies will signal<br />
the place where the poets died;<br />
Via Appia.</p>
<p>Bugs that frighten me<br />
scatter me in my silence.<br />
Can&#8217;t turn on the light.</p>
<p>What we will become:<br />
Insect robots created<br />
with anguish and steel.</p>
<p>Flies of the future:<br />
Nanorobot memories<br />
of humanity.</p>
<p>Piping is over;<br />
Supersedure now begins.<br />
Long live the new queen.</p>
<p>What does space smell like?<br />
It smells like honey sulfer<br />
stung by our being.</p>
